Est. 2016 serving local food that's vegetarian and vegan, with dishes like asam laksa, hokkien mee, jawa mee, loh mee, among others Uses natural ingredients. Previously at 32 Jalan Moulmein Pulau Tikus and called Pin Xin Vegan Delight. Open Mon-Sun 11:00am-8:30pm. Last orders 8:15pm.

Delicious fancy food

This felt like quite a fancy place when we arrived and the food lived up to that first impression.

We ordered the satay, hokkien noodles and curry noodles. The texture of the fake meat in the satay was great, and the sauce was nice too. We were glad to find chunks of the same fake meat alongside tofu in both the other dishes. We were told that the fake meat in the satay is made from monkey mushrooms.

The flavour of everything was really good, and it was a treat to find some Malaysian classics in a place where we knew everything was vegan. It also wasn't super expensive compared to some places we've been recently, even though it felt very high-end.
